版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
2026年计算机工程师技术笔试题库一、单选题(每题2分,共10题)考察方向:数据结构与算法基础、操作系统原理1.在快速排序算法中,选择枢轴元素时,哪种方法的时间复杂度最稳定?A.随机选择B.选择第一个元素C.选择中间元素D.选择最后一个元素2.在Linux系统中,进程调度算法中优先级调度(非抢占式)的优先级计算通常基于什么指标?A.CPU使用率B.内存占用量C.进程运行时间(CPU时间)D.I/O请求次数3.哈希表解决冲突的链地址法中,当哈希表装载因子达到0.7时,推荐采用什么策略?A.直接删除冲突元素B.重新哈希(rehashing)C.动态增加链表长度D.减少哈希函数复杂度4.在TCP协议的三次握手过程中,如果客户端发送SYN报文后长时间未收到服务器响应,可能的原因是?A.服务器防火墙阻止了SYN包B.客户端本地网络延迟C.服务器已关闭TCP连接D.以上都有可能5.Linux系统中,`grep`命令用于查找文件中的字符串,若要忽略大小写,应使用哪个选项?A.`-i`B.`-v`C.`-r`D.`-l`二、多选题(每题3分,共5题)考察方向:计算机网络、数据库基础6.以下哪些属于HTTP/2协议的改进特性?A.多路复用(Multiplexing)B.头部压缩(HeaderCompression)C.单一连接(SingleConnection)D.服务端推送(ServerPush)7.在关系型数据库中,以下哪些操作会触发触发器(Trigger)?A.插入(INSERT)B.更新(UPDATE)C.删除(DELETE)D.查询(SELECT)8.TCP/IP协议栈中,哪些层属于网络层?A.IP层B.ICMP层C.ARP层D.TCP层9.分布式数据库中,实现数据一致性的常用方法包括?A.两阶段提交(2PC)B.三阶段提交(3PC)C.本地缓存一致性D.Paxos算法10.DNS解析过程中,客户端向本地DNS服务器发送查询时,可能遇到的响应类型包括?A.NXDOMAIN(域名不存在)B.A记录(IPv4地址)C.CNAME记录(别名)D.MX记录(邮件服务器)三、判断题(每题1分,共10题)考察方向:操作系统、信息安全基础11.在多道程序系统中,若CPU时间片过长,会导致系统吞吐量下降。12.堆栈溢出(StackOverflow)通常由递归调用层数过多引起。13.SSH协议默认使用端口22,且支持公钥认证。14.SQL注入攻击利用的是数据库SQL语句的拼接漏洞。15.RAID5通过数据条带化和奇偶校验实现高容错性。16.在Linux系统中,`rm-rf`命令会直接删除目录及其所有内容,无需确认。17.基于角色的访问控制(RBAC)比访问控制列表(ACL)更适用于大型系统。18.TCP协议是面向连接的,UDP协议是无连接的。19.在分布式系统中,CAP定理指出系统最多只能同时满足一致性(Consistency)、可用性(Availability)和分区容错性(PartitionTolerance)中的两项。20.沙盒(Sandbox)技术可以完全隔离应用程序的运行环境,防止恶意代码执行。四、简答题(每题5分,共4题)考察方向:数据库设计、网络安全21.简述数据库事务的ACID特性及其含义。22.解释什么是跨站脚本攻击(XSS),并说明常见的防御措施。23.在分布式缓存(如Redis)中,主从复制(Master-SlaveReplication)的原理是什么?24.什么是零日漏洞(Zero-dayVulnerability)?企业应如何应对此类威胁?五、编程题(每题15分,共2题)考察方向:算法实现、系统设计25.题目:设计一个函数,实现快速排序算法。输入为一个整数数组,输出为排序后的数组。要求:-使用递归方式实现;-选择枢轴元素为中间值(即中位数);-示例输入:`[3,1,4,1,5,9,2,6,5,3,5]`,输出:`[1,1,2,3,3,4,5,5,5,6,9]`。26.题目:假设你需要设计一个简单的日志系统,支持以下功能:-将日志追加到文件中;-按时间戳对日志进行排序;-支持按关键词搜索日志。请简述系统设计思路,并说明你会使用哪些数据结构和算法实现这些功能。答案与解析一、单选题答案1.C-快速排序的枢轴选择对性能影响较大。随机选择或固定位置(如首尾)可能因输入数据特性导致最坏情况时间复杂度(O(n²))。选择中间元素(分位数)可平衡性能。2.C-非抢占式优先级调度基于进程优先级,优先级通常与CPU时间相关,优先级越低(数值越小)优先级越高。3.B-装载因子超过0.7时,哈希冲突概率显著增加,推荐重新哈希到更大的表空间。4.D-以上均可能导致SYN未响应:防火墙过滤、网络延迟或服务器拒绝连接。5.A-`grep-i`忽略大小写,其他选项分别表示忽略行、递归搜索、仅输出文件名。二、多选题答案6.A、B、D-HTTP/2改进:多路复用、头部压缩、服务端推送。单一连接是HTTP/1.1特性。7.A、B、C-触发器仅响应DML操作(INSERT/UPDATE/DELETE),SELECT不会触发。8.A、B、C-TCP/IP网络层包括IP、ICMP、ARP。TCP属于传输层。9.A、B、C-2PC/3PC是分布式事务协议,本地缓存一致性是缓存同步方法。Paxos是共识算法,不直接用于数据一致性。10.A、B、C、D-DNS响应类型包括NXDOMAIN、A、CNAME、MX等。三、判断题答案11.正确-长时间片会导致低优先级进程饥饿,系统吞吐量下降。12.正确-深度递归会耗尽栈空间。13.正确-SSH默认22端口,公钥认证更安全。14.正确-攻击者构造恶意SQL语句执行非法操作。15.正确-RAID5通过奇偶校验实现数据冗余。16.正确-`-rf`表示递归删除且不提示。17.正确-RBAC通过角色管理权限,适合大型系统。18.正确-TCP三次握手建立连接,UDP无连接。19.正确-CAP定理限制分布式系统设计。20.错误-沙盒不能完全隔离,仍可能存在逃逸风险。四、简答题答案21.数据库事务的ACID特性:-原子性(Atomicity):事务要么全部完成,要么全部回滚,不可部分执行。-一致性(Consistency):事务执行后数据库从一致性状态转移到另一个一致性状态。-隔离性(Isolation):并发事务互不干扰,如同串行执行。-持久性(Durability):事务提交后结果永久保存,即使系统崩溃也不会丢失。22.跨站脚本攻击(XSS):-定义:攻击者向网页注入恶意脚本,在用户浏览器执行,窃取信息或篡改页面。-防御:-输入验证(过滤特殊字符);-输出编码(HTML实体转义);-使用CSP(内容安全策略)限制脚本执行源。23.Redis主从复制原理:-主节点处理所有写入请求,通过RDB快照或AOF日志将数据同步到从节点。从节点可接受读请求,提高可用性。24.零日漏洞:-定义:软件存在未公开的漏洞,攻击者可利用而开发者未知。-应对:-及时更新补丁;-启用防火墙和入侵检测;-限制敏感操作权限。五、编程题答案25.快速排序实现(Python):pythondefquick_sort(arr):iflen(arr)<=1:returnarrmid=len(arr)//2pivot=arr[mid]left=[xforxinarrifx<pivot]middle=[xforxinarrifx==pivot]right=[xforxinarrifx>pivot]returnquick_sort(left)+middle+quick_sort(right)26.日志系统设计思路:-数据结构:-使用文件追加模式记录日志;-内存中维护时间戳排序的队列或平衡树(如AVL树)优化搜索。-算法:-日志追加:按时间戳插入队列;-搜索:二分查找关键词。-实现:-
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 幼儿园校车接送路线优化与耗时分析-基于2023年GPS轨迹数据与家长反馈
- 智慧城市实施方案模板
- 台球安全生产管理制度
- 脑出血护理个案查房
- 口语交际:名字里的故事【活动探究版】
- 化学反应与能量变化 模块2 化学反应与电能 寒假衔接讲义
- 勇敢出发:2026级高一心理韧性培育与生涯启航主题班会教学设计
- 高中二年级“健康第一·五育融合”开学启航主题班会教案
- 践行丝路精神·铸就大国担当-高中地理选择性必修2《国际合作》教学设计
- 向海图强:海洋空间资源开发与国家安全教案(高中地理·选择性必修3)
- 2026云南昆明供电局项目制用工招聘48人笔试模拟试题及答案解析
- 2026云南高创人才服务有限公司招聘6人笔试备考试题及答案解析
- 全胃切除病人全程营养管理中国专家共识(2026版)
- 2026年四川成都市中考地理试卷含答案
- 2025-2026 学年人音版初中音乐八年级下册全册知识点梳理
- 2026年自贡市自流井区社区工作者招聘笔试参考试题及答案解析
- 2026年版闲鱼卖货实战手册(选品+定价+爆款打造完整攻略)
- 雨课堂学堂在线学堂云审计法律研究与案例(西南政法大学)单元测试考核答案
- “十五五”规划纲要应知应会100题及答案
- 2026安徽合肥市发展和改革委员会上半年招聘事业单位工作人员20人考试备考试题及答案解析
- 限额以下小型工程常见安全隐患指导手册(2026版)
评论
0/150
提交评论